😐A single person spends $1,375 per month in Guadalajara vs $1,219 in Acuna, rent included.
😐A couple spends around $2,241 per month in Guadalajara vs $1,937 in Acuna, rent included.
😐A family of three spends $3,107 per month in Guadalajara vs $2,656 in Acuna, rent included.
😐Guadalajara costs about 13% more than Acuna, driven mainly by Eating Out.

Guadalajara vs Acuna: Cost of Living - Frequently Asked Questions
Is Acuna cheaper than Guadalajara?
Yes – Guadalajara is pricier by about 13%, and the gap shows up most in Eating Out. It's not just housing either; the difference applies across most spending categories.
What income do you need for each city?
For a comfortable life, plan on about $2,062 per month in Guadalajara and $1,829 in Acuna. That covers rent, food, utilities, transport, and enough left over to feel settled – not just surviving.
Which city has lower housing costs?
Rent is clearly cheaper in Acuna, especially for central apartments. Housing is actually the single biggest factor behind the overall cost gap between these two cities.
Is eating out cheaper in Guadalajara or in Acuna?
A mid-range dinner for two costs $49.00 in Guadalajara and $46.00 in Acuna. That's a good indicator of the overall restaurant and café pricing gap between the two cities.
How do food prices compare in Guadalajara and in Acuna?
Groceries cost about 4% more in Guadalajara, though it depends on what you buy. Local produce may be comparable; imported and premium items show the biggest price gap.
Is $1,500 a realistic budget for living in Guadalajara or in Acuna?
A $1,500 monthly budget goes further in Acuna, where all-in costs run around $1,219, than in Guadalajara at $1,375. In Acuna it covers expenses comfortably, while in Guadalajara it requires careful planning or may not stretch far enough.
Is Guadalajara or Acuna more family-friendly?
Families tend to lean toward Acuna – lower housing and cheaper childcare make a real difference, especially on a single income or when paying for private education.
